  • I think it's hard to know until you're at the end of your options. I had a couple of fertiles tell me "oh, I could NEVER do IVF."  Of course you couldn't! You've never even had to think about it!

    We were never going to do IVF...until we had no other choice and realized we'd always rather have another baby than, say, a new car.  We managed to get the money together, but it wasn't easy.

    Our FET was the end, though.  We were emotionally and physically exhausted and felt like we had given it our all.  Fortunately, that worked.
